Betrayal. Danger. Redemption.

Archaeologist, Dr. Tory Winters, unearths an unfathomable--and dangerous--find at the Temple of the Stars in Norte Sierra. Her only hope for escaping the dig site with her prize and life is to enlist Rafael "Guerrero" Stanford, an ex-American federal agent, for help. Too bad for her, Guerrero's wife was murdered for the same discovery and he refuses to return to the temple that in his mind holds nothing but nightmarish memories he'd rather forget. When Tory won't take no as his answer, he finds himself immersed in a lethal battle to save a legendary treasure and both of their lives.

Margaret Daley, an award-winning author of seventy-six books, has been married for over forty years and is a firm believer in romance and love. When she isn’t traveling, she’s writing love stories, often with a suspense thread and corralling her three cats that think they rule her household. I love stories that are located in other parts of the world! This one is in Central America on an archeological dig and someone is willing to kill for the artifacts that are found there. There is betrayal, danger and redemption. Dr. Tory Winters enlists "Guerrero" Stanford to help her at the dig site to keep her and the other workers safe because a lot of danger has happened there. Guerrero's wife was killed for this same discovery 3 years ago and he doesn't want to help Tory but he can see that she is in danger so finally relents and helps her. What follows is non-stop action. Trying to guess who is behind all of this will take all of their wits! Along the way, they just might fall in love. I loved all the action and the archeology goings on. It was fascinating! A fantastic story from a great writer!

One might question how one petite, young archaeologist can dig up so much trouble when she and her team are digging for artifacts at the ruins of an ancient Mayan temple. After being referred to Guerrero for protection for her and the site, the problems seem to escalate. I think I would have gone looking for a safer occupation rather than hanging around there expecting someone who clearly did not want to be there to protect me. One thing is certain: the story does not lack for suspense and action. Tory seems to be facing life-threatening events at almost every turn. She is definitely one stubborn young lady. If Guerrero says stay, she is determined to go. The reader will have to determine whether that is a good or bad thing. Although Guerrero is bitter about something in his past for which he has declared he will get revenge, it is refreshing that he is open to the voice of God.
